If I could give this place zero stars, I would…read more I boarded my male 2 1/2-year-old Yorkiepoo here for a weekend and picked him up on Sunday. When I got him back, his stomach and paws were covered in dried up urine and was clearly not acting like himself. Over the next two days, he had rectal bleeding that continued for two days, refused to eat for three days, and was severely dehydrated. I immediately contacted Ruff Resort to let them know what was happening with my dog, but I never received a response. I ended up taking him to the veterinarian, where he underwent multiple examinations. Between the exams and treatment, I spent over $700 trying to determine what was wrong. The vet did confirm he was severely dehydrated. A two day boarding ultimately cost me $1000. After not hearing back, I called the facility today to ask if they were open because I wanted to speak with someone in person. They told me they had tried to text me. They claimed the first message bounced back but that a second message went through. However, I never received any text on my phone. More importantly, if a customer contacts you to report that their dog became seriously ill after staying at your facility, the appropriate response is to pick up the phone and call them--not rely on text messages, especially if you already know one message failed to deliver. The lack of urgency, communication, and concern was incredibly disappointing. My dog's health and well-being should have been the priority, and instead I was left dealing with a very sick dog, expensive veterinary bills, and no meaningful response from the facility.
